Output 57354e5bd18f32cb23cccbd1b9bec330c7372d2444e048f178fa7322919a3395:0

value
28789182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e1e066693ce64a0427c6bba390ae142e91f814 OP_EQUAL
address
3BFanfyehMVCqz1MrCdEgHzhr8M1GiTci9
transaction
57354e5bd18f32cb23cccbd1b9bec330c7372d2444e048f178fa7322919a3395
confirmations
375112
spent
true